Unable to access start menu in ME

The start menu is unaccessible and My Computer only opens up a blank window. I get a error message from IE;

"Your current sercurity settings prohibit running Active X controls on this page."

Even in safe mode the start menu is unaccessible. Though I can see the drives in My Computer where I couldn't in normal mode. This isn't my box, it's a Comtrash with a KZ133 chipset MB.

Any ideas?

Hi videobruce

The two easiest repairs for this would be to use System Restore or the scanreg command line utility to restore a saved Registry from before the problem's appearance.

Here's Microsoft's article on how to start System Recovery from the command prompt in WinMe http://support.microsoft.com/?kbid=279736

To use the scanreg method, perhaps the easiest way would be to boot from a bootable WinMe floppy (you can download one from http://www.bootdisk.com ) and try the "scanreg /restore" command (without the quotes) to restore a saved copy of the registry.

Registry errors for either Java Script or Active X can cause this kind of behavior. For example, see http://support.microsoft.com/default...;EN-US;q309663

If these efforts don't work, an over-the-top likely would http://forum.pcmech.com/showthread.php?t=70846

Best of luck
. . . Gary

[I'd probably use the scanreg tool as a first try]
